My mom has had a cold for 2 week, how does she get rid of it? |
Ive heard that your suppose to only have a cold for 7 days. But shes had it for 2 weeks. She has the running nose, yellow snout, clogged nose, coughing, and tiredness. Is this even a cold? Thanks alot :] well sometimes if you have a serious cold it over stays its welcome.it's nothing to worry about too much. it sounds like she has nasal and chest congestion. have her drink lots of tea. an make sure she inhales the steam from the tea or anything else. there are things such as vapor creams and other things that you can buy for a few dollars at any drug store that help clear nasal and chest congestion fast. make sure she gets a lot of sleep so she can save up her energy. you have to make sure she is eating healthy. soup and broth is great [ no creamy soups] and you need her to get something solid down so also give her a piece or toast. if she wants to she can take medicine. if you are already doing this or did this and it didn't work, call the family doctor and make an appoitment ASAP or if she is too weak to get out of the house ask him to make a house call. i hope this helpes and your mother's health is returned to her soon!!!!
